Narendramodi - 10 things to know with detail
  • Early Life: Narendra Modi was born on September 17, 1950, in Vadnagar, a small town in Gujarat, India. He comes from a humble background and worked at his father's tea stall as a child.
  • Political Career: Modi joined the Rashtriya Swayamsevak Sangh (RSS), a Hindu nationalist organization, at a young age. He rose through the ranks of the Bharatiya Janata Party (BJP) and eventually became the Chief Minister of Gujarat in 2001.
  • Gujarat Riots: Modi's tenure as Chief Minister of Gujarat was marred by the 2002 Gujarat riots, in which over 1,000 people, mostly Muslims, were killed in communal violence. Modi has faced criticism for his handling of the riots and has been accused of turning a blind eye to the violence.
  • Economic Reforms: As Chief Minister of Gujarat, Modi implemented various economic reforms that helped boost the state's economy. His "Gujarat model" of development focused on infrastructure projects, industrial growth, and attracting foreign investment.
  • Prime Minister of India: Modi led the BJP to a landslide victory in the 2014 general elections and became the Prime Minister of India. He was re-elected in 2019 with an even larger majority.
  • Swachh Bharat Abhiyan: One of Modi's flagship initiatives as Prime Minister is the Swachh Bharat Abhiyan, a nationwide cleanliness campaign aimed at improving sanitation and hygiene in India. The campaign has seen some success in reducing open defecation and improving sanitation facilities.
  • Demonetization: In 2016, Modi announced the demonetization of high-denomination currency notes in an effort to curb corruption and black money. The move was met with mixed reactions, with critics pointing to the economic disruptions it caused.
  • Make in India: Another major initiative of Modi's government is the "Make in India" campaign, which aims to promote domestic manufacturing and boost the country's economy. The campaign has led to various reforms and incentives for businesses to invest in India.
  • Foreign Policy: Modi has placed a strong emphasis on India's foreign relations, with a particular focus on strengthening ties with countries in the Asia-Pacific region and improving relations with major powers like the United States and Russia.
  • Personal Style: Modi is known for his charismatic leadership style, strong communication skills, and use of social media to connect with the public. He is also known for his fashion sense, often seen wearing traditional Indian attire on official occasions.
